Transaction 93ada539acfa880fffe79485a21d788b077e159e6f744631578ba5706989cec8

2 Input
2 Outputs
  • 93ada539acfa880fffe79485a21d788b077e159e6f744631578ba5706989cec8:0
  • value  141700
    address  18WmuMgsbsuQSQHicW72NrmSWs9dgSCbRT
  • 93ada539acfa880fffe79485a21d788b077e159e6f744631578ba5706989cec8:1
  • value  1013707
    address  3QjKdA8nPxbVYryhBpEaVkjzHhQio7r4ZB